探秘老边app:深入分析高级开发技巧

作者:抚顺麻将开发公司 阅读:20 次 发布时间:2025-05-25 07:58:25

摘要:老边app是一款备受欢迎的社交软件,为用户提供了丰富多彩的交友、聊天、分享等功能,深受用户喜爱。本文将深入探秘老边app高级开发技巧的实现原理,通过分析不同模块的实现方式,为高级开发者提供有价值的经验和技巧。文章共分为五个部分:界面设计、后台开发、数据存储、性能优化和安全防护,每个部分均从技术层...

  老边app是一款备受欢迎的社交软件,为用户提供了丰富多彩的交友、聊天、分享等功能,深受用户喜爱。本文将深入探秘老边app高级开发技巧的实现原理,通过分析不同模块的实现方式,为高级开发者提供有价值的经验和技巧。文章共分为五个部分:界面设计、后台开发、数据存储、性能优化和安全防护,每个部分均从技术层面详细介绍,以期为读者提供全面的、深入的技术实践指引。

探秘老边app:深入分析高级开发技巧

  1. 界面设计

  老边app的用户界面设计简洁、美观,给人一种轻松愉悦的使用体验。在界面设计方面,老边app采用了现代化的设计风格,强调交互体验和用户体验。其中,界面设计的交互体验表现在:

  (1)酷炫的下拉刷新效果

  老边app的下拉刷新效果非常独特,展现了高超的动画技术。在用户下拉列表时,下拉刷新图标会出现翻转旋转等酷炫效果,让人耳目一新。

  (2)自定义的动画效果

  老边app中很多元素都拥有自己的动画效果,如按钮点击的波纹效果、用户卡片滑动的动画效果等。这些自定义动画效果极大地增强了用户的交互体验。

  2. 后台开发

  老边app的服务器端采用了高可用、高并发、高性能的技术实现,保证了系统的稳定性和可靠性。在后台开发方面,老边app借鉴了一些优秀的技术架构和框架,包括:

  (1)采用了分布式架构

  在系统架构上,老边app采用了分布式架构,将不同的模块分配到不同的服务器上,以达到负载均衡和高并发的目的。同时,系统还采用了集群技术,保证了系统的高可用性。

  (2)选用高效的数据库系统

  为了保证数据存储的高效和可靠性,老边app采用了高效的数据库系统,如Redis、MongoDB等。这些数据库系统在性能、扩展性和可靠性方面具有很强的优势,使得系统能够快速、稳定地处理大量的数据。

  3. 数据存储

  老边app的数据存储采用了分布式、高性能、可靠的方案,为用户提供了快速、稳定的数据服务。在数据存储方面,老边app采用了以下技术手段:

  (1)采用了NoSQL数据库

  为了更好地管理海量数据,老边app采用了NoSQL数据库,如MongoDB、Redis等。这些数据库具有高性能、高可靠性等特点,可以为用户提供快速、稳定的数据服务。

  (2)使用缓存技术

  为了提高数据访问的效率,老边app采用了缓存技术,将常用数据缓存在内存中。这样一来,数据的访问速度更快,用户的体验也更加优秀。

  4. 性能优化

  老边app在性能优化方面做了很多努力,包括页面加载优化、代码优化、资源优化等。以下是老边app在性能优化方面做出的一些技术手段:

  (1)使用异步方式加载页面

  为了提高页面的加载速度,老边app采用异步方式加载页面,将页面中复杂的模块通过ajax等技术加载。这样一来,用户可以更快地浏览和使用页面,提高了用户体验。

  (2)对代码进行压缩和合并

  为了提高系统的性能和资源利用率,老边app对代码进行压缩和合并,减少了HTTP请求的次数。同时,采用了GZIP压缩技术等手段,减少了网页传输的数据量,提高了网页加载速度。

  5. 安全防护

  老边app在安全防护方面做到了极致,采用了多种技术手段提升系统的安全性和保障用户的隐私。以下是老边app在安全防护方面的一些技术手段:

  (1)采用SSL/TLS协议

  为了保证用户数据传输的安全,老边app采用SSL/TLS等安全传输协议,避免了网络数据的窃取和篡改,保障了用户的隐私。

  (2)加强用户密码安全

  为了防范黑客攻击和密码猜测等行为,老边app采取了加强用户密码安全的措施。例如采用复杂的密码规则、限制密码输入次数、使用防暴力破解密码技术等,保证了用户密码的安全性。

  综上所述,老边app在界面设计、后台开发、数据存储、性能优化和安全防护等方面都采用了高端的技术手段,为用户提供快速、稳定、安全的服务。在深入分析老边app高级开发技巧的过程中,我们从技术角度审视了老边app的优秀实践,也为高级开发者提供了一些有价值的技术指导。我们相信,在不断探索技术的过程中,老边app将会越来越完美,更好地满足广大用户的需求。

  老边app是一款提供旅游攻略、美食推荐等服务的APP,其开发涉及到众多高级技巧。本文将深入探秘老边app的开发过程,并从多个方面分析其高级开发技巧。

  1. 软件架构的设计与实现

  老边app采用了MVC(Model-View-Controller)的设计模式,这种模式是将软件应用分为三个部分:模型(Model)、视图(View)和控制器(Controller)。其中,模型层负责对数据的封装和存储,视图层处理数据的展示,控制器则负责对模型层和视图层进行管理和协调。

  2. 响应式布局的实现

  老边app为了适应不同屏幕尺寸的需求,采用了响应式布局的设计模式。在实现响应式布局的过程中,通过CSS的media query来实现,不同分辨率的屏幕采用不同的CSS文件来实现布局的调整。

  3. 优化图片加载的实现

  为了提高用户体验,老边app采用了图片异步加载技术。在页面加载完成后,先将图片的src属性赋值为占位符,然后再使用JavaScript动态加载图片,并在图片加载完成后再次修改其src属性为真实的图片地址。

  4. 高效的后台数据处理

  老边app后端采用了基于Nginx的负载均衡集群架构,同时采用了Redis实现缓存机制,大大提高了数据的处理效率。在具体的代码实现上,采用了分布式锁和对象池等技术来提高系统的并发处理能力。

  5. 测试和优化的实现

  在开发过程中,老边app采用了持续集成和自动化测试的流程,每次代码提交后会触发持续集成自动化测试流程,通过自动化测试来保证代码质量和系统稳定性。同时,系统运行过程中还会采集性能数据,通过分析性能数据来进行系统优化。

  经过对老边app的深度剖析和分析,我们可以看到,在开发一款优秀的APP时,需要考虑很多因素。软件架构的设计、响应式布局、图片加载、后台数据处理和测试优化都是影响整个app体验的关键因素。掌握这些高级开发技巧,才能让我们的应用在市场上占据自己的一席之地。

  • 原标题:探秘老边app:深入分析高级开发技巧

  • 本文链接:https://qipaikaifa.cn/qpzx/383013.html

  • 本文由抚顺麻将开发公司中天华智网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部